At the end of April, a large technology company headquartered in Seattle posted a new job for a developer position. The following numbers correspond to that posted job:
3: Number of hours the opening was posted
1,573: Number of applications received
900: Number of applications deemed unqualified by the applicant tracking system (ATS) “robot”
1: Recruiter assigned to fill this position
1: Hiring manager who will choose the finalists
